There's actually an agreement between the FFTT and the CTTA, that's why there are actually many top 100/200 WR chinese players involved in the Pro A, like Xiang Peng, Xu Yingbin, Sun Wen and so on.
This has led to a major controversy this season: as the CSL has been scheduled in mid season, December for instance because of the Paris Olympics, the CTTA stated that the chinese athletes could play the phase 1 in France, but not the phase 2. The french leagues are organized in 2 phases: from September to December, then from January to June.
The FFTT stated also that NO athletes could be involved in 2 different leagues at the same time, means here foreign leagues, if those leagues are organised by ITTF affiliated associations. That's why at Jura Morez's french Pro A club Aruna can play the MLTT (not organized by the USATT) and the french Pro A at the same time, but Sun Wen could not play the Pro A after being hired to play the CSL, organised by the CTTA. Jura Morez decided to put Sun Wen on the team after January and has been sanctioned, leading to an awful drama when Jura Morez's President decided to withdraw from the Pro A: he could not bear to pay Sun Wen for only one phase and not being able to put him on the team for the playoffs next June. At that time Jura Morez was the leader of the Pro A
Now guess what ? this agreement will let the Lebrun Bros. being hired for the next CSL in.... July (no Pro A championship), and the FFTT has decided to remove that "2 leagues" rule that led to too much drama. Means there will be much more foreign players in the Pro A, much more french players making money elsewhere, and more chinese players allowed to play both phases of the french Pro A because of the CTTA/FFTT agreement.
